About the Clinic

Morton Plant Mease Health Services operates multiple hospitals in northern Pinellas County and West Pasco County, FL, providing specialized and technical care across various medical fields including women's care, orthopedics, heart, cancer, and neurosciences.

Accreditations

Primary Stroke Center re-certification by The Joint Commission (Mease Countryside Hospital, Morton Plant North Bay Hospital)

Hospital Affiliations

Morton Plant Hospital, Mease Countryside Hospital, Mease Dunedin Hospital, Morton Plant North Bay Hospital
